Wrocław Multimedia Fountain, the largest fountain in Poland and one of the biggest in Europe, is a captivating attraction located in Szczytnicki Park near the Centennial Hall. With 800 lights and 300 water jets, this majestic fountain offers enchanting choreographed shows set to classical and modern pop music. Visitors can enjoy these magical displays every hour during its operational months from April to October.

Szczytnicki Park, located in Wroclaw, is a picturesque destination that offers a blend of natural beauty and cultural attractions. The park features a renowned Japanese garden established in 1913 and rebuilt multiple times. Ostrów Tumski in Wrocław is a historically and architecturally significant site, featuring remnants of early habitation, including a wooden church. Situated on the Oder River, it is the oldest part of the town and the center of religious life with numerous churches and chapels. Undoubtedly, Cathedral Island (Ostrów Tumski) is the heart and spiritual soul of Wroclaw. Hidtirically, the current Gothic cathedral is the fifth iteration, built in the 13th–14th century that makes it the first  Gothic church in Poland. It has twin towers and the interior has breath taking instructure. blends Gothic structure with Baroque and Renaissance details added over centuries. Based on historical documents, the cathedral was heavily damaged in WWII when German forces used it as an ammunition depot. However,  its post-war reconstruction is the proof and testament of the huge work that has been done to keep it in such a stunning and amazing piece of art in Wrocław. One of my absolutely favourite places in Wroclaw!! Definitely a MUST SEE! Plus cause of it’s very central location incredibly easy to reach! It’s the oldest part of the city of Wroclaw. It was formerly an island between branches of the Oder River. Archaeological excavations have shown that the western part of Ostrov Tumski, between the Church of St. Martin and the Holy Cross, was the first area to be inhabited. The first, wooden church (St. Martin), dating from the 10th century, was surrounded by defensive walls built on the banks of the river. The island had approximately 1,500 inhabitants at that time. The first constructions on Ostrov Tumski were built in the 10th century by the Piast dynasty, and were made from wood. The first building from solid material was St. Martin's chapel, built probably at the beginning of the eleventh century by Benedictine monks. Not long after the first cathedral was raised, in place of the small church. Religious buildings appeared in Ostrov Tumski because during the Congress of Gniezno in AD 1000, it was decided to create a bishopric in Wrocław.

Ogród Japoński, located within Szczytnicki Park, is a serene Japanese-style garden that dates back to the city's 1913 World Exposition. Recently restored with the help of the Japanese Embassy, it features authentic Japanese elements such as cascading waterfalls, oriental bridges, granite lanterns, and ornamental gates surrounding a large central lake. The garden is known for its seasonal beauty, boasting cherry blossoms in spring and vibrant fall foliage.

Aquapark Wrocław, established in 2008, is a top water park in Europe that offers a blend of relaxation areas, recreational activities, and wellness facilities. The complex features indoor and outdoor pools with thrilling slides, a Lazy River, and a children's play area. Additionally, visitors can enjoy the sports pool, fitness club, and various saunas throughout the year.

The City Museum of Wroclaw, located in the 18th-century royal palace known as Palac Krolewski, offers a comprehensive exploration of Wroclaw's rich history. Visitors can immerse themselves in the city's 1000-year narrative through captivating exhibits and artifacts within the palace and its baroque garden.

Leśnica Castle, a cultural center housed within an ancient castle, showcases exhibitions featuring the works of Polish artists and illustrators. Situated just inside Wroclaw city limits, this nearly 900-year-old castle has a rich and tumultuous history, having changed ownership multiple times. Accessible by tram or train from the Main Station, the castle now serves as the Zamek Cultural Center. Its graceful architecture and historical significance make it one of Wroclaw's top landmarks.

The carousel costs 2zl per person per ride, which is an amazing price; the cotton candy only costs 3zl or 5zl, and is prepared by a guy clearly in love with his job. This man - I should have asked his name - is great with children, and showed great patience even when a group of kids from a summer school descended on his little spot in Wroclaw.
Christopher W — Google review
The carousel costs 2 złoty per ticket, but the big show is actually the cotton candy. It costs either 3 or 5 złoty (small/large) and the guy selling it actually puts on a show while making it! He makes the cotton candy float around like smoke. It is spellbinding for kids and adults. The large, by the way, is absolutely massive, like the size of a small beach ball.

Nadodrze, an up-and-coming neighborhood in Wroclaw, is characterized by its vibrant street art decorating 19th-century buildings and courtyards. The area boasts modern Polish designs showcased in galleries and homeware shops, alongside organic bakeries, delis, vegetarian cafes, and bohemian bars.
